#d7fd59 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d7fd59 is composed of 84.3% red, 99.2%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15% cyan, 0% magenta, 64.8%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 73.9 degrees, a saturation of 97.6% and a lightness of 67.1%. #d7fd59 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ffb2 with #affb00. Closest websafe color is: #ccff66.

#d7fd59 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d7fd59 has RGB values of R:215, G:253, B:89 and CMYK values of C:0.15, M:0, Y:0.65,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 14155097.

Shades and Tints of #d7fd59
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070800 is the darkest color, while #fcfff4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d7fd59
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#adafa7 is the less saturated color, while #d7fd59 is the most saturated one.
